内存流 什么是内存流和文件流

seosqwseo4个月前 (07-25)测评日记40

一、微型计算机的内存主流技术是

DDR(Double Data Rate)是用于系统的RAM技术,其特点是高带宽、低延时。DDR总线每个Channel是64**t宽度,每根Data的管脚(DQ)可以进行读*作或写*作(不同时)。目前的新标准是DDR4,数据线可以支持到3200MT/s,而DDR5是未来的技术,数据速率会再翻倍。

GDDR(Graphics Double Data Rate),是用于显示的RAM技术,其特点是高带宽、高延时。GDDR5技术实际来源于DDR3,只不过降低了电压,减少了位宽(但支持更多Channel),通过数据编码和读写线分开提高了数据速率(3G~6GT/s)。GDDR5已经使用了将近10年,目前新的标准是GDDR6。

从数据速率上来说,GDDR更高,适合显示图像这种需要大数据量传输而对时延不太敏感的场合;而DDR技术由于延时小,所以更适合于CPU这种数据随机读取的场合。

据内部可靠消息,由于DDR5的数据速率已经达到甚至超过了现在一些串行总线的数据速率,所以DDR5芯片的接收端还会采用在串行总线上广泛应用的可变增益放大器VGA(variable gain amplifier)、可变Delay(通过DLL实现)以及4阶DFE(decision feedback equalizer)均衡技术以优化采样位置和眼图的质量。下图是DDR5芯片接收端的设计架构。

另外,DDR5还会采用HBM的封装以提高内存芯片的密度和通道数。High Bandwidth Memory(HBM)技术早来源于AMD、Hynix、UMC、Amkor、ASE等公司,是一种高速的3D封装的RAM接口技术。第一代的HBM技术在2013年被JEDEC协会采纳(JESD235标准),代表产品是AMD公司代号为Fuji的GPU芯片(下图);而其第二代的HBM2技术也在2016年被JEDEC协会采纳(JED235A标准),代表产品是nVidia公司的Tesla P100芯片。目前,第三代的HBM3技术也在开发过程中,并将用于未来的DDR5芯片上。

HBM技术可以把多8层DRAM的Die堆叠起来,并通过TSV(Through-Silicon Vias:硅通孔)技术和内存控制器通过相应的Interposer互联起来。在HBM接口中,内存控制器和和不同的Die间采用独立的Channel进行互联,各个Channel间互相没有关系,因为可以进行独立的时序设计以提高数据传输速率。比如在采用4层Die堆叠、每个Die有2个Channel、每个Channel有128**t宽度时,如果采用4颗芯片,则总的数据位宽= 4(Stack)*4(Die)*2(Ch)*128(**t)= 4096**t。

二、什么是内存流和文件流

文件流 FileStream继承与Stream类,一个FileStream类的实例实际上代表一个文件流,使用FileStream类可以对文件系统上是文件进行读取、写入、打开和关闭*作。与ioStream、sStream共同作为头文件构成IO标准库。

内存流 MemoryStream表示的是保存在内存中的数据流,由内存流封装的数据可以在内存中直接访问。内存一般用于暂时缓存数据以降低应用程序对临时缓冲区和临时文件的需要。

引入内存流是因为内存流和字节数组虽然都位于程序缓冲区,但是具有不同特性。内存流相对于字节数组而言,具有流特有的特性,并且容量可自动增长,在数据加密以及对长度不定的数据进行缓存等场合,使用内存流比较方便。

扩展资料:

MemoryStream有多种构造函数如下:

1、public MemoryStream();该构造函数初始分配的容量大小为0,随着数据的不断写入,其容量可以不断地自动扩展。

2、public MemoryStream(byte[] buffer);根据字节数组buffer初始化,实例的容量大小规定为字节数组的长度。

3、public MemoryStream(int capacity);容量固定为capacity。

三、内存整理的原理是什么

很多程序运行的时候需要占用很多内存.即使程序退出后仍然无法完全释放。

内存整理就是干这个的。

例如:如有个内存整理软件Freeram,你让它整理内存后,它就向windows要了128M的内存,也可能更多,看你的选择,windows一看内存没那么多了,就把一些东西放到虚拟内存里来腾地方,然后给128M的物理内存给Freeram,Freeram一看内存到手了,立刻释放掉了这128M内存(就是告诉windows 128M的内存我又不要了),于是物理内存空出来128M,

四、如何播放内存流中的mp3音乐

如果想播放存储装置里的一个文件夹的歌曲,需要设置MP3播放机。

*作如下:

首先,确认MP3播放机的存储卡内,包含有文件夹,并且该文档里面有歌曲。

1:打开MP3播放机,在播放模式下,按“暂停"键.

2:一定要在暂停状态下,按"M"键一下,出现的界面里,选择”文件浏览“,继续按"M"键一下,进入内部存储来查看目录,按上、下键,将光标移动到出现的文档总目录上(文档的后面都有两个点),按"M"键一下,关闭当前播放目录(此时按一下打开该文档,再按一下关闭该文档),关闭后该目录后面的两个点变为一个点。接下来,在出现的界面里,找到需要播放的文档,光标选定,按"M"键一下,进入该文档。光标下移,选择任意一首歌曲后,按:"播放"键,即可播放歌曲。此时播放的歌曲的范围,就是需要播放的文档目录。

3:*作完成后,屏幕中间会显示该文档的歌曲数量,播放过程中,如果是循环播放,MP3播放机只播放该文档的歌曲,而不播放文档以外的歌曲。

注意:*作过程中,上次按键和下次按键中间间隔的时间有限制!一般都在5秒之间,如果超过5秒不进行下一次按键,系统会返回按键之初的播放状态!所以,要熟悉*作顺序和按键位置,快速*作,才可设置成功。

相关文章

索尼(SONY)KD-43X85K43英寸怎么样?质量测评好不好用?

索尼(SONY)KD-43X85K43英寸怎么样?质量测评好不好用?

很多小伙伴在关注索尼(SONY)KD-43X85K43英寸怎么样?质量好不好?使用测评如何?本文综合已购用户的客观使用分享和相应的优惠信息,为大家推荐一款高性价比的产品,一...

夏普(SHARP日本原装面板全面屏手机投屏智能语音HDR网络4K超高清液晶60|70英寸平板电视机质量好吗

夏普(SHARP日本原装面板全面屏手机投屏智能语音HDR网络4K超高清液晶60|70英寸平板电视机质量好吗

很多小伙伴在关注夏普(SHARP日本原装面板全面屏手机投屏智能语音HDR网络4K超高清液晶60|70英寸平板电视机怎么样?质量好不好?使用测评如何?本文综合已购用户的客观使...

小米(MI)小米电视EA好不好用

小米(MI)小米电视EA好不好用

很多小伙伴在关注小米(MI)小米电视EA怎么样?质量好不好?使用测评如何?本文综合已购用户的客观使用分享和相应的优惠信息,为大家推荐一款高性价比的产品,一起来看看吧。...

Camorama凯眸4K全景运动摄像机车载支架测评怎么样

Camorama凯眸4K全景运动摄像机车载支架测评怎么样

很多小伙伴在关注Camorama凯眸4K全景运动摄像机车载支架怎么样?质量好不好?使用测评如何?本文综合已购用户的客观使用分享和相应的优惠信息,为大家推荐一款高性价比的产品...

荣耀手环7全天候血氧监测好不好

荣耀手环7全天候血氧监测好不好

很多小伙伴在关注荣耀手环7全天候血氧监测怎么样?质量好不好?使用测评如何?本文综合已购用户的客观使用分享和相应的优惠信息,为大家推荐一款高性价比的产品,一起来看看吧。...

索爱(soaiy)MC39无线k歌手机麦克风话筒歌唱录音主播声卡套装唱歌神器儿童音响一体无线蓝牙家庭ktv怎么样?质量测评好不好用?

索爱(soaiy)MC39无线k歌手机麦克风话筒歌唱录音主播声卡套装唱歌神器儿童音响一体无线蓝牙家庭ktv怎么样?质量测评好不好用?

很多小伙伴在关注索爱(soaiy)MC39无线k歌手机麦克风话筒歌唱录音主播声卡套装唱歌神器儿童音响一体无线蓝牙家庭ktv怎么样?质量好不好?使用测评如何?本文综合已购用户...